Job Resources and Work Engagement: Optimism as Moderator Among Finnish Managers

2014

The aim of the present study was to investigate the moderating role of optimism in the relationship between job resources (organizational climate, job control) and work engagement among Finnish young managers (N = 747). Hierarchical regression analyses showed that both job resources and optimism exerted a positive effect on work engagement and its three dimensions of vigor, dedication, and absorption. The moderation results showed that optimism can diminish the negative impact of low job resources on work engagement. To nie były wolne wybory : prasa polskiej emigracji politycznej w Wielkiej Brytanii wobec wyborów do Sejmu PRL z 20 stycznia 1957 roku

2018

Wybory do Sejmu PRL z 20 stycznia 1957 r. odbiły się żywym echem wśród emigracji polskiej w Wielkiej Brytanii. W artykule przedstawiono opinie i oceny emigracyjnych polityków i publicystów dotyczące przebiegu kampanii wyborczej i wyniku wyborów w 1957 r.
